Opera Mini exclusively redesigned for India with Bollywood & Cricket card

New Delhi: Opera Mini, the web browser designed primarily for mobile phones, smartphones and personal digital assistants, has got even better with new features and integrations. It now includes India-specific updates on Bollywood and Cricket on its home page. On its home page, Opera Mini 18 will show a new entertainment feed and the company has partnered up with Bollywood Hungama for this purpose. To give live updates on cricket, it has partnered with Sportskeeda. So now you will be able to get all sports update on its home page. The ability to download videos onto the smartphone from the browser is another new feature of this updated version. The company will essentially allow users to download videos from social networking and other sites onto their devices from the browser directly. By clicking on the option, a pop-up dialogue box, with the convenient to save the video will appear. Users can then touch the 'save button' and start downloading or press cancel to just stream it online.However, the feature only works on video websites without their own integrated media player. Opera Mini updated version also introduced 'Video Boost' feature and as the name suggests, it would help Opera Mini users see less of the video-buffering.
